The fields that can be configured are described below:
Parameter Description
System Name Enter a system name for the Switch, if so desired. This name will identify it in the Switch
network.
System Location
Enter the location of the Switch, if so desired.
System Contact
Enter a contact name for the Switch, if so desired.
Serial Port Auto
Logout Time
Select the logout time used for the console interface. This automatically logs the user out after
an idle period of time, as defined. Choose from the following options: 2 Minutes, 5 Minutes, 10
Minutes, 15 Minutes or Never. The default setting is 10 minutes.

This window contains the main settings for all major functions
for the Switch and appears automatically when you log on. To
return to the Device Information window, click the DES-
30xx Web Management Tool folder. The Device
Information window shows the Switch’s MAC Address
(assigned by the factory and unchangeable), the Boot PROM,
Firmware Version, and Hardware Version. This
information is helpful to keep track of PROM and firmware
updates and to obtain the Switch's MAC address for entry into
another network device's address table, if necessary. The use
may also enter a System Name, System Location an
System Contact to aid in defining the Switch, to the user's
preference. In addition, this window displays the status o
functions on the Switch to quickly assess their current global
status. Some functions are hyper-linked to their configuratio
window for easy access from the Device Information
window.
